Women’s Entrepreneurial Opportunity Project

March 10, 2015
-
News

Women’s Entrepreneurial Opportunity Project, also known as WEOP, is an Atlanta based organization whose mission is to promote the economic advancement of women through technology, education and training.  On the 19th of March, WEOP is hosting a Women’s History Month Event at GA Power’s Arkwright Auditorium. Registration is $25 and the event is slated to start at 9 a.m.. Attendees will  have the opportunity to attend panel sessions that will address economic opportunities, business success strategies, technology and marketing, and accessing capital. The flyer posted below provides a schedule of events as well as all the guest speakers who will be in attendance.
